Position: Production Associate

Duties:

  • Assemble door units (interior or exterior) according to company standards and customer specifications
  • Operate woodworking machinery and tools (saws, nail guns, routers, drills, sanders, measuring tapes)
  • Read and interpret work orders, blueprints, or job specifications for door type, size, material, and hardware requirements
  • Cut, fit, and fasten door components, including jambs, frames, sills, stops, and trim pieces
  • Install glass inserts, sidelights, weatherstripping, and thresholds as required
  • Attach hinges, locks, handles, and other hardware to doors or frames using hand and power tools
  • Inspect doors and components for defects or damage before and after assembly
  • Sand, seal, or finish door surfaces if required (depending on production line setup)
  • Label and prepare finished doors for packaging or shipment

QUALIFICATIONS/REQUIREMENTS:

  • Minimum of 2 years of Door shop experience asset but willing to train the right person
  • Ability to stand and walk for long periods of times, and bending and crouching
  • Ability to safely lift, carry and position doors, frames and materials (often 50, sometimes more with assistance)
  • Ability to handle tools, hardware, and small components precisely and safely
  • Ability to read measurements defects and ensure proper fit and finish of assembled doors
  • Able to maintain consistent work speed and quality throughout an entire shift

About Lynden Door Inc.

Lynden Door, Inc. manufactures residential, architectural, and commercial interior doors. We offer a blended product portfolio of molded panel & flush interior doors suitable for a wide range of specifications and budgets. Our manufacturing facility located in the US - Pacific Northwest, serves customers in single & multi family, office tower, hospitality, educational, medical & health care segments in the USA and Canada.

A leader in door design since 1978, trust Lynden Door to be your guide in rediscovering doors as a design element.

Allied companies include: Alliance Door Products (2-step wholesale of interior and exterior doors, millwork), Lynden Door Trucking ( covering the regions of Washington, Oregon, Idaho, California, Utah, Montana, British Columbia and Alberta) and Source Engineering ( Engineering, designing and building manufacturing equipment )
